Cable Users: If you have CABLE TV and used the Cable Box
setup on the Cable Connections (page 7) using a cable box con-
verter, you must tune the VCR to the cable box output channel
(usually CH 3 or 4). Change channels with the cable box instead
of the VCR.

• The AUTO mode determines how much tape is left and
switches speed from SP to SLP, if necessary, to complete
recording the program. There will be some picture and sound
distortion at the point of the speed change.

ONCE event....for recording up to 8 programs on a single day
or over the days within a period of 1 year.
WEEKLY event....for recording up to 8 programs on a certain
day of every week.
DAILY event....for recording up to 8 programs at the same
time(s) Monday through Friday.
